Hamiltonian Treatment of the Complete Vacuum Schwarzschild Geometry

The complete vacuum Schwarzschild geometry is considered in its Hamiltonian form. There exists no canonical transformation that will make the constraints linear in the momentum canonically conjugate to the new time label. Consequently, no classical field exists such that its quantization on a flat background will be equivalent to the quantization of this geometry. A particular slicing shows that there are no true dynamical degrees of freedom even inside the horizon.
